Optimal Times For Pool & Spa Assessments

Strategic scheduling of swimming pool inspections maximizes value and minimizes risks during various ownership and transaction scenarios.

  • Pre-Purchase Evaluation: Complete inspections before closing to identify costly repairs and negotiate price adjustments.

  • Seasonal Start-Up: Assess conditions before peak swimming season to ensure operational readiness.

  • Property Listing Preparation: Evaluate pool conditions before marketing to address buyer concerns.

  • Safety Compliance Review: Schedule periodic inspections to maintain barrier and equipment standards.

  • Equipment Upgrade Planning: Document existing conditions before replacing pumps, heaters, or filtration systems.
